[Photo Story] Penn State Women’s Hockey Splits Weekend Series With RIT

This past weekend, Penn State women’s hockey team returned to Pegula Ice Arena to take on RIT in a two-game series.
In case you missed it, here are some of our favorite photos of the weekend games.
Friday
Early in the game, the Nittany Lions found their rhythm. Maddy Christian scored early, giving Penn State an early edge.



Mikah Keller also found the back of the net to tie up the game in the third period.



After a hard fight in overtime, the Nittany Lions fell to the Tigers 3–2.

Saturday
Penn State returned to the ice Saturday afternoon, where the Nittany Lions struck early and maintained offensive pressure throughout the game.




Goals from Keller, Kendall Butze, and two from Christian fueled the offense.Â



RIT pushed late in the second period, but Penn State responded in the third to secure the win.
